Program Overview

Arizona State University s PhD program in Animal Behavior one of the few in the world combines faculty from many disciplines and academic units to offer interdisciplinary training in both classic and cutting-edge concepts and techniques in the field. Students in the program develop research competence in animal behavior that welcomes and encourages the integration of approaches from physiology, ecology, evolution, psychology, anthropology, kinesiology, mathematics, neuroscience, and applied science (e.g. domestication, conservation). Core coursework includes a field- and lab-based research course as well as student-driven seminars that cover emerging themes in the literature. The overall aim of the program is to provide the ideal academic environment for students to carve unique intellectual and integrative research niches in their respective areas of animal behavior.
